The bus to Iraklion goes 4 times a day and needs 1 1/2 hours. Here is the link to the ktel-krete, the busservice:
KTEL-CRETE
Matala has very nice beache - its really to far away to go by bus to elafonissi and chrissi. So - take a walk to the red beach or to komos beach. Go to Pitsidia, Kamilari and Kalamaki. In Pitsidia you'll feel real Crete life.
By boat you can go to the holy gorge - agio farango. Also the monastiry of Odigitria is nearby. Try to visit the marked of Mires every Saturday...
As Pam did try to hire a car or a bike and find place, you'll not reach with a bus...
A week in Matala is very short. There is so much more to see as Pam and I told you... But - I think you'll enjoy also your 7 days...

The Patris from 2.11.2005
*Το Τυμπάκι θα είναι οριστικά η περιοχή όπου θα γίνει το λιμάνι - μαμούθ που θέλουν οι Κινέζοι. Οι πληροφορίες της “Π” για σχεδόν κλεισμένη συμφωνία επιβεβαιώνονται από την απαντητική επιστολή του προέδρου της China Shipping Group Li kelin προς τον υπουργό Εμπορικής Ναυτιλίας κ. Κεφαλογιάννη.
“Μοιράζομαι την πίστη σας ότι το Τυμπάκι και όλα τα χαρακτηριστικά του είναι μια καλή περιοχή για διαμετακομιστικό κέντρο” αναφέρει ο πρόεδρος της κινέζικης εταιρείας. Ο οποίος και ουσιαστικά αποκαλύπτει ότι προϋπήρξαν συζητήσεις και κατ’ αρχήν συμφωνίες για το Τυμπάκι.
Ο χώρος του ανενεργού σήμερα αεροδρομίου μαζί με την όλη περιοχή είναι 8000 στρέμματα. Τα οποία ανήκουν στο Ελληνικό Δημόσιο (Αεροπορία) και πολύ ευκολότερα μπορούν να παραχωρηθούν για να προχωρήσει η επένδυση.
Παράλληλα πρόκειται για μια περιοχή - ταψί, έτοιμες δηλαδή... αποβάθρα και προβλήτες, ενώ υπάρχει και ο διάδρομος προσγείωσης.
Στην επιστολή του ο Κινέζος πρόεδρος πλέκει το εγκώμιο της Κρήτης λέγοντας ότι είναι η ιδανική επιλογή - λόγω της γεωγραφικής της θέσης - για να αναπτυχθεί ένα διαμετακομιστικό κέντρο για την ανατολική Μεσόγειο, τη Μαύρη Θάλασσα και την περιοχή γύρω από την Αδριατική.
Ο κ. Λ. Κελιν γράφει στον κ. Κεφαλογιάννη ότι θα πρέπει να συνεχιστούν οι συζητήσεις με αντιπροσωπεία του υπουργείου που θα μεταβεί στη Σαγκάη.
Τέλος, αναφέρεται με θερμά λόγια στη φιλοξενία της κυβέρνησης και των Κρητικών λέγοντας ότι ήταν το “highlight” του όλου ταξιδιού στην Ευρώπη.*
I don't know, how much is true. But are here any user from crete are knowing more??? The harbour shoud be bigger than the harbour of Piraeus. Premier Karamanlis will be on Crete on the 17. of December. Members of the chinese shipping company visited Crete in the last time...
